Transaction e80931a7681951b6476c67ca48e1f86981a511ff6ebe69e9ea0c5e577f1292a3
1 Input
1 Output
-
e80931a7681951b6476c67ca48e1f86981a511ff6ebe69e9ea0c5e577f1292a3:0
- value
- 9537847
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6e7704eb7c7b16424ecb2b922a998172e4b9412d OP_EQUAL
- address
- 3Bm6qFBe6fScecnDwbdZvNWZgfUPeVdrBY